How much do events associ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for events associate in Delaware is $19.50,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.55 and $20.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Events Associ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Events Associate,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ience in event planning, often supported by a degree in hospitality or a related field. Familiarity with event management software, budgeting tools, and standard office applications is typically required. Exceptional interpersonal skills, adaptability, and problem-solving abilities help you stand out when coordinating with vendors, clients, and team members. These skills ensure seamless event execution, client satisfaction, and the ability to handle unexpected challenges effectively.

How does an Events Associate typically collaborate with vendors and internal teams during the planning process?

As an Events Associate, you’ll frequently coordinate with both external vendors (such as caterers, venues, and audiovisual suppliers) and internal teams (like marketing, sales, and operations) to ensure all event details are aligned. This involves regular communication, managing timelines, and confirming deliverables to keep everyone on track. Strong organizational and interpersonal skills are essential, as you’ll be the link between multiple stakeholders, troubleshooting issues and adapting to last-minute changes. These collaborations help ensure events run smoothly and meet organizational objectives.

What does an Events Associate do?

An Events Associate helps plan, coordinate, and execute events such as conferences, meetings, and social gatherings. Their responsibilities typically include managing logistics, communicating with vendors and attendees, assisting with event setup and breakdown, and ensuring that all aspects of the event run smoothly. Events Associates often work closely with event managers and other team members to deliver a successful experience for guests and clients.

What is the difference between Events Associate v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vents AssociateEvent Coordinator
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er associate's degreeHigh school diploma; often prefers associate's or bachelor's degree in hospitality, marketing, or related field
Work EnvironmentAssist in event setup, registration, and support; often in office or event venuesPlan, organize, and oversee event execution; work on-site and in offices
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in hospitality, non-profits, corporate eventsUsed across hospitality, corporate, and nonprofit sectors
Common Search & Comparison IntentYesYes

While both roles support event planning, the Events Associate typically provides support tasks like registration and setup, often in entry-level positions. The Event Coordinator takes on more responsibility for planning, managing vendors, and overseeing the event's execution. Both roles are essential in the event industry but differ in scope and responsibilities.

CONTEXT OF THE JOB:

Under the general direction of the Senior Director of University Events, the Associate Director of Strategic Special Events manages the planning and execution of special events designed to engage, cultivate and steward prospective and current donors for the University of Delaware. The Strategic Special Events portfolio includes high-profile, signature campus, regional and national events and those planned on behalf of the President's Office, Provost's Office, University Secretary's Office, Development and Alumni Relations and other key campus partners.

M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Plan and manage high-end development events that support fundraising goals through creation of strategic programming and effective experience design to achieve established event objectives and outcomes.
  • Serve as a primary point person and resource for other staff, such as Alumni Engagement, gift officers, academic units, athletics, senior leadership, and UD leaders in event identification and planning to ensure consistent event standards, collaborative strategies and defined partnerships that best serve University Constituents and meet defined goals.
  • Work collaboratively with DAR and campus partners to identify, propose, and plan strategic event opportunities that incorporate the President and other senior level leaders (Provost, Deans, Board of Trustees) in building and strengthening relationships with prospective and current donors
  • Lead the strategic development of immersive donor events that drive fundraising and engagement. Position will collaborate with internal and campus partners to ensure event programs align with philanthropic goals while managing budgets, timelines, and communications to achieve desired outcomes.
  • Develop, organize, implement, and evaluate short and long-range event plans and goals designed to drive donor engagement and increase philanthropic support of the University.
  • Guide other event team members and campus partners on incorporating in person event strategies and develop management practices for virtual and hybrid events that expand donor engagement opportunities and enhance relationships between donors, prospects and the University.
  • Serve as liaison to event attendees and steward them through the event process.
  • Craft and manage effective production and event timelines with clearly defined goals, responsibilities, and deadlines to ensure timely completion of tasks.
  • Arrange logistics for event operations through the selection process for event venues, including site visits, contract negotiations, and relationships with vendors, event staffing, menus, set up and floor plans, seating, parking, transportation, signage, decor, floral, lighting, photography and media services. Build effective working relationships with on-campus and off-campus vendors and suppliers, including tent companies, lighting companies, movers, catering, florists, electricians, etc.
  • Define measurable event outcomes in partnership with the Senior Director of University Events and internal stakeholders, clearly articulating desired results for each event and evaluating return on investment when applicable."
  • Manage multiple, simultaneous deadlines and event-related processes.
  • Monitor and evaluate event outcomes providing actionable recommendations for continuous improvement Perform miscellaneous job-related duties as assigned.
  • Oversee event-related procurement compliance by ensuring the successful execution of all university procurement policies, processes, and procedures related to event financial management, and partners with DAR Finance to ensure appropriate budget allocation.
  • Perform miscellaneous job-related duties.

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Bachelor's degree and four years' experience in high-end event planning and/or project management, preferably in a higher-education environment,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Effective oral and written communication skills.
  • Strong interpersonal skills.
  • Strong project management, discernment, and problem-solving skills. Ability to make independent decisions and judgments in keeping with the level of the position.
  • Ability to work well under pressure and manage projects simultaneously.
  • Effective time management and organizational skills.
  • Ability to work effectively with diverse constituents from all disciplines including donors, faculty, staff, and students.
  • Proficiency with basic computer programs such as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ook).
  • Ability to handle sensitive material and information confidentially. 

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S:

Flexibility to work nights and weekends, as needed. Occasional travel required to support regional and national events, meetings, and other responsibilities as needed.
